Ingredients

serves 18
  • 2 cups minus 2 tablespoons cake flour ((8 1/2 ounces))
  • 1 2/3 cups bread flour ((8 1/2 ounces))
  • 1 1/4 teaspoons baking soda
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ons coarse salt
  • 1 1/4 cups unsalted butter
  • 1 1/4 cups packed light brown sugar ((10 ounces))
  • 1 cup plus 2 tablespoons granulated sugar ((8 ounces) )
  • 2 large eggs
  • 2 teaspoons pure vanilla extract
  • 1 1/4 pounds bittersweet chocolate disks ((at least 60 percent cacao content))
  • Sea salt
